Qualcomm tackles C-V2X connectivity gaps
Recognising the inherent safety concerns with gaps in C-V2X connectivity, Qualcomm has developed a way to extend coverage to places where Global Navigation Satellite System (GNSS) signals are not available—such as a long tunnel or deep parking structure.

Aeye has eyes on the lidar prize
AEye and its system integrator partners are showcasing the unrivalled flexibility of software-configurable Lidar to support any ITS application and improved 3D perception. Demonstrations include long- and short-range detection capabilities for automated tolling, incident detection, pedestrian traffic flow and smart intersection safety, powered by AEye’s 4Sight perception solution.

Miovision Scout Explore points the way to success
Miovision Scout Explore expands on the capabilities of Miovision Scout, a portable video-based traffic data collection solution. This next-generation model is even easier to transport and set up since all components are contained within the device.

Citymos simulation product is market-ready
CityMoS says its City Mobility Simulator has matured from a research project in Singapore to a market-ready mobility simulation product. The spin-off company, called intobyte, provides computational modelling using CityMoS, a simulation mobility platform.

Play hard, work smart with Castle Rock
An innovative ‘Worker Presence’ reporting feature is part of the Smart Work Zone and WZDx integrations from Castle Rock Associates, a specialist in capturing and sharing travel knowledge. It is being demonstrated on the company booth along with its other software deployments in Colorado, Indiana, Minnesota, California, Massachusetts, Kansas, Nebraska and Iowa.
